Prince of Persia: The Sands of Time is definitely worthy of carrying around the PoP name. Unlike the previous 3d incarnation of the franchise, Sands of Time captivates the player the entire time through with a really enjoyable and fun experience. Graphically, the game is a joy to watch. While it doesn't run at 60 fps or have the high poly count of other games, the world comes to live with beautiful textures, an oversaturated dream like look, and environments that are fun to interact with as well as logical in progression. Sounds are top notch as well, with various SFX heard as the prince runs through the environment. The music is ambient and subtle until combat kicks in - where it tries to pick up the pace. I didn't pay *too* much attention to the music, but it never bothered me so that must be a good thing :) Gameplay wise, people have various opinions of course. The game is short - 8-10 hours or so, however, with all these games coming out I actually prefer this so I can play it entirely. Combat is not 'floatie' in my opinion - I think more than anything combat and all the movement just feel like an extension of your hand - it's really easy to execute a good series of attacks. It does become drawn out towards the end, but creatures begin to become more difficult and you can't just simply run up a guy and back swipe him. Camera occasionally gets in the way, but nothing too bad. The most important thing though was that every single room and puzzle I progressed through in the game was enjoyable and rewarding once you figured it out. Overall, I found the game to just be really, really fun. I'm a die-hard PoP fan so I am glad to see they carried over a lot of the concepts and then some from the original 2d games (which both are also included as extras).
